Evita Peron Quotes
» Answer violence with violence. If one of us falls today, five of them must fall tomorrow.
» I am my own woman.
» I know that, like every woman of the people, I have more strength than I appear to have.
» I will come again, and I will be millions.
» If I have to apply five turns to the screw each day for the happiness of Argentina, I will do it.
» In government, one actress is enough.
» Keeping books on social aid is capitalistic nonsense. I just use the money for the poor. I can't stop to count it.
» My biggest fear in life is to be forgotten.
» Time is my greatest enemy.
» When the rich think about the poor, they have poor ideas.
» Charity separates the rich from the poor; aid raises the needy and sets him on the same level with the rich.
» I am only a simple woman who lives to serve Peron and my people.
» I am only a sparrow amongst a great flock of sparrows.
» I will return and I will be a million.
» One cannot accomplish anything without fanatacism.
» Shadows cannot see themselves in the mirror of the sun.
» Suffer little children and come unto me.
» The nation's government has just handed me the bill that grants us our civil rights. I am receiving it before you, certain that I am accepting this on behalf of all Argentinean women, and I can feel my hands tremble with joy as they grasp the laurel proclaiming victory.
» To convince oneself that one has the right to live decently takes time.
» When the rich think of the impoverished, they think of impoverished desires.
» Where there is a worker, there lies a nation.
» I had watched for many years and seen how a few rich families held much of Argentina's wealth and power in their hands. So Peron and the government brought in an eight hour working day , sickness pay and fair wages to give poor workers a fair go .
» I demanded more rights for women because I know what women had to put up with.
